import { StreamLanguage } from "@codemirror/language";
const mermaidStreamParser = StreamLanguage.define({
token(stream) {
// Comments: %%...
if (stream.match(/^%%.*$/)) {
return "comment";
}
// Strings
if (stream.match(/^"(?:[^"\\]|\\.)*"/)) {
return "string";
}
// Diagram type keywords (at start of line or after whitespace)
if (
stream.match(
/^(flowchart|graph|sequenceDiagram|classDiagram|stateDiagram|erDiagram|gantt|pie|mindmap|journey|gitGraph|timeline|quadrantChart|sankey|xychart)\b/i,
)
) {
return "keyword";
}
// Direction keywords
if (stream.match(/^(TB|TD|BT|RL|LR)\b/)) {
return "keyword";
}
// Keywords
if (
stream.match(
/^(subgraph|end|participant|actor|loop|alt|else|opt|par|critical|break|rect|note|over|activate|deactivate|title|section|class|style|linkStyle|classDef|click)\b/i,
)
) {
return "keyword";
}
// Arrows: -->, ---, -.->, ===>, etc.
if (stream.match(/^[-.=<>|ox]+>/)) {
return "operator";
}
if (stream.match(/^<[-.=<>|ox]+/)) {
return "operator";
}
if (stream.match(/^--+|\.\.+|==+/)) {
return "operator";
}
// Labels in brackets/parens: [text], (text), {text}, ((text)), etc.
if (stream.match(/^[[\](){}|<>]/)) {
return "bracket";
}
// Node IDs (alphanumeric)
if (stream.match(/^[A-Za-z_][A-Za-z0-9_]*/)) {
return "variableName";
}
// Numbers
if (stream.match(/^\d+(\.\d+)?/)) {
return "number";
}
// Punctuation
if (stream.match(/^[,:;]/)) {
return "punctuation";
}
// Skip whitespace
if (stream.eatSpace()) {
return null;
}
// Skip any other character
stream.next();
return null;
},
});
export function mermaidLite() {
return mermaidStreamParser;
}

const MERMAID_SYNTAX_ERROR_LINE = /(?:Parse|Lexical) error on line (\d+)[.:]/i;
const MERMAID_INACTIVE_PARTICIPANT_ERROR =
/Trying to inactivate an inactive participant \((.+)\)/i;
const MERMAID_CARET_LINE = /^\s*-+\^\s*$/;
export const isMermaidParseSyntaxError = (message: string) =>
MERMAID_SYNTAX_ERROR_LINE.test(message);
export const isMermaidAutoFixableError = (message: string) =>
isMermaidParseSyntaxError(message) ||
MERMAID_INACTIVE_PARTICIPANT_ERROR.test(message);
export const isMermaidCaretLine = (line: string) =>
MERMAID_CARET_LINE.test(line);
export const getMermaidInactiveParticipant = (
message: string,
): string | null => {
const match = message.match(MERMAID_INACTIVE_PARTICIPANT_ERROR);
if (!match?.[1]) {
return null;
}
return match[1].trim();
};
const escapeRegExp = (value: string) =>
value.replace(/[.*+?^${}()|[\]\\]/g, "\\$&");
const getInactiveParticipantLineNumber = (
message: string,
sourceText: string,
): number | null => {
const participant = getMermaidInactiveParticipant(message);
if (!participant) {
return null;
}
const deactivatePattern = new RegExp(
`^\\s*deactivate\\s+${escapeRegExp(participant)}(?:\\s+%%.*)?\\s*$`,
);
const lines = sourceText.split(/\r?\n/);
for (let index = lines.length - 1; index >= 0; index--) {
if (deactivatePattern.test(lines[index])) {
return index + 1;
}
}
return null;
};
export const getMermaidErrorLineNumber = (
message: string,
sourceText?: string,
): number | null => {
const match = message.match(MERMAID_SYNTAX_ERROR_LINE);
if (!match) {
if (!sourceText) {
return null;
}
return getInactiveParticipantLineNumber(message, sourceText);
}
return Number.parseInt(match[1], 10);
};
const countMatches = (text: string, re: RegExp) =>
(text.match(re) || []).length;
export const getMermaidSyntaxErrorGuidance = (
message: string,
sourceText?: string,
): { summary: string; likelyCauses: string[] } | null => {
if (!isMermaidParseSyntaxError(message)) {
return null;
}
const errorLine = getMermaidErrorLineNumber(message, sourceText);
const summary = errorLine
? `Syntax error near line ${errorLine}.`
: "Syntax error in Mermaid diagram.";
const likelyCauses: string[] = [];
if (sourceText) {
const openBrackets = countMatches(sourceText, /\[/g);
const closeBrackets = countMatches(sourceText, /\]/g);
if (openBrackets !== closeBrackets) {
likelyCauses.push("Unbalanced square brackets in a node label.");
}
const openParens = countMatches(sourceText, /\(/g);
const closeParens = countMatches(sourceText, /\)/g);
if (openParens !== closeParens) {
likelyCauses.push("Unbalanced parentheses in a node shape.");
}
const openBraces = countMatches(sourceText, /\{/g);
const closeBraces = countMatches(sourceText, /\}/g);
if (openBraces !== closeBraces) {
likelyCauses.push("Unbalanced braces in a decision node.");
}
const subgraphCount = countMatches(sourceText, /^\s*subgraph\b/gm);
const endCount = countMatches(sourceText, /^\s*end\s*$/gm);
if (subgraphCount > endCount) {
likelyCauses.push("A block is missing an `end` statement.");
}
}
if (/got 'NODE_STRING'/.test(message) || /got 'PS'/.test(message)) {
likelyCauses.push(
"An extra character/token may appear after a node or label definition.",
);
}
if (likelyCauses.length === 0) {
likelyCauses.push(
"A node or edge line is malformed (missing/extra delimiters).",
);
likelyCauses.push("A block (`subgraph`, `class`, etc.) may be incomplete.");
}
return {
summary,
likelyCauses: [...new Set(likelyCauses)],
};
};
export const formatMermaidParseErrorMessage = (message: string) => {
if (!isMermaidParseSyntaxError(message)) {
return message;
}
return message.replace(/\n\s*Expecting[\s\S]*$/, "").trimEnd();
};
